Resumen del Editor

Author Miles Van Meter is on a book tour to promote his sensational best seller Sleeping Beauty, a true-crime account of a deeply personal subject: the attack by a serial killer that left his twin sister, Casey, in a coma. Tonight the audience waits to hear Miles discuss recent developments in his sister's case, unaware that pieces of this complex puzzle of violence, unknown even to the author, are about to be revealed.

Six years earlier, life was much simpler for everyone involved, especially 17-year-old Ashley Spencer, a popular high school soccer star. Then one night an intruder entered Ashley's home and murdered her father and her best friend. Traumatized and suffering from a crippling sense of survivor guilt, Ashley is ready to give up on both soccer and life until help comes from an unexpected source, a scholarship to an elite private school is extended to her by school dean Casey Van Meter. The school quickly becomes a haven for both Ashley and her mother, Terri. As Ashley regains her sense of self through the school's soccer program, Terri joins a writing group for adults led by Joshua Maxfield, a former literary wunderkind who has disappeared from the best seller lists since his second book was panned by both critics and fans.

Then tragedy strikes again and Ashley has to run for her life, unaware that the key to her survival is in the one book she's afraid to read, Sleeping Beauty.

Sleeping Beauty

Someone reviewing (not very favorably) Grisham's "The Last Juror" recomended Phillip Margolin, so I tried "The Undertaker's Widow". It was great, kept me guessing up to the last chapter. "Sleeping Beauty" was even better. The narrator, Suzanne Houston, was excellent. Right up there with Michael Beck, one of my favorites. Suzanne did such a good job bringing the characters to life for me, especially DDA Delilah Wallace. Her voice characterizations were not overdone. There was a subtle difference in each character that was just enough to identify them without distracting me from the story.
Margolin's story kept me interested from beginning to end. I've learned to suspect the obvious, so doubted the key suspect from the beginning. But that did not help me see around corners to see what was coming. And Margolin kept heaping it on so I began to doubt my conclusions. The story was full of surprises for me. I liked his characters, they were all pretty believeable and, again, not overdone. I'm back for more.
